Physical Activity and Exercise
Regular physical activity is indispensable for maintaining not only physical health but also enhancing mental acuity and emotional well-being. Activities that range from cardiovascular exercises to strength training can improve heart health, boost mood through endorphin release, and increase longevity. Getting in at least 150 minutes of aerobic activity at a moderate intensity alongside regular strength training each week is strongly linked to a significantly reduced risk of acquiring severe long-term conditions, including diabetes and heart disease, according to numerous studies. Tailoring an exercise regimen that aligns with personal interests and abilities encourages consistency and long-term adherence.
Sleep and Its Significance
Quality sleep serves as a foundation for both mental and physical health. When sleep is inadequate or frequently disrupted, it can lead to a spectrum of adverse health consequences, including difficulties with thinking, elevated stress, weight increase, and reduced immunity. Creating a calm bedroom atmosphere, sticking to a regular sleep routine, and minimizing blue light exposure from technology before bed are all ways to encourage restful sleep. The National Sleep Foundation offers a plethora of guidelines and practical tips to optimize sleep hygiene and enhance restorative rest periods.
Stress Management Strategies
In today’s fast-paced world, stress is a common adversary that can have far-reaching impacts on health if not appropriately managed. Stress has been linked to cardiovascular problems, mental health disorders, and weakening of the immune defense. Adopting effective stress management approaches such as mindfulness, meditation, and yoga can help reduce stress. Stress management is an essential component of any health program since these exercises have been shown to reduce stress hormones, enhance relaxation responses, and enhance general mood and well-being.
